Type
ORACLE
Validation date
2024-02-21 05:13: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03849,
    "usd": 0.04162
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00016189CE0C5F5D5D25321AF4065BEBE27F2EEB1FA85D16FF0C41445767723C8421

Previous signature

5563C6B7D52B0F301E7F26EC4A0FB101F8A266967F964CE2750A62FB1CB25B0750E2B5FD72D6A0C596D1B372D3B27EA20740C39D0FC7BF4F22D7AC11EC786308

Origin signature

3045022100B0113C31F8C4D39FEACD30974601B4C1D848397E4852526B7B184BD5AC263E300220636B555E76CF2E1B99308E9BECC0FA8676B5B1E2F21CA035A7628206502C4BD1

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00E083914A89FA2D9342858CBC4384EA70D1815DA454EC7A5DD8E527F9969B5605

Coordinator signature

DC398B188B950B1F3B0028240780B285AD2004CD68349659F4B5CA7BCCE13D5558B58C5771A601B7296B361324FE67D32477C1D8C5EEE2F309A1E22E3D7CD100

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

652AD202C9DDC4C39949B3149351D68A651EDF3B88D48AA8CA23582A07C6C3ED07F2EDA7C6CEF15BCC71026BC922F745F9719FD1AE7194B45581D9FA8D69A80B

Validator #2 public key

0001B01EEF96BA7E95FC844D456CE8868F18864519FC9532E1751C2035FD044DD5D0

Validator #2 signature

3CF45757A306AC84F74BD5A5106E463A51180ECA9BC25F9CC278E36D7BDF88990A191366468DF295D9BCEFF66AB171E5AF4BBD117380CA5C284DE46738AE0305